I have never had the memory leak problem, and have been using this since it
was Phoenix. I just upgraded to 2.0.0.15, and it reared it's ugly head.

I left the browser open all day with about 5 tabs open, something I've
often done with no problem. When I tried to browse again after work,
everything moved like molasses. I opened Task manager to find that Firefox
was using over 500 mb of memory. I've never seen it higher than about 80
mb.

close FF and then click on the windows start button, then
run and enter:

firefox.exe -safe-mode

this will start FF in safe mode.  Does the problem continue?
 Also, you might want to upgrade to FF3.  Some of the leak
problems have been fixed there.  Not all, but some.
